Are Playpens Good for Babies?
Yes, baby playpens have great benefits for both babies and parents. Simply put, a playpen is a safe space where your baby can explore. You do not have to worry about them getting into trouble.
Safety First, Peace of Mind: A playpen acts as a strong wall against falls, cords, or eating bad things. It allows parents to step away for a few minutes. You do not have to be stressed all the time. Imagine a typical day for a parent: there are dishes to be washed, laundry to be folded, and meals to be prepared, all while ensuring that the baby is safe and attended to.
Builds Independent Play Skills: A playpen teaches your baby to play by themselves without help all the time. This is a key step in growing their focus and problem-solving skills.
Starts Learning Boundaries: Babies learn that the world has safe boundaries. This sets the stage for learning rules and good habits later on.
Are Playpens Necessary?
To be strict, a playpen is not a must-have for parenting, they undeniably offer an added layer of safety for children in homes where potential hazards cannot be completely eliminated.
If you have a better-designated area in your home for your child to play safely, or if you have enough manpower to watch your child around the clock, you don’t necessarily need to buy a playpen.
No law says you need a playpen, but the safety and ease they offer are worth a lot. In modern parenting, their value is in filling a gap that older safety steps, like baby gates, cannot fill.
A baby gate keeps your baby in a room. A playpen gives 100% safety in one small, clear area. This means you can cook in the kitchen while your baby plays safely nearby, staying in your view. Also, for homes with pets or older kids, a playpen gives the baby a safe spot away from others.

What Age Is Best for Playpen?
A playpen can be used from when your baby is born until they are a toddler, from about 6 months to 2 and a half years old. The best time to use one is usually when the baby starts crawling (around 6 months) until they can stand well. In this stage, they are curious and moving more, but they cannot judge danger yet.
Introducing a playpen too early, before a baby has developed sufficient motor skills and strength to sit up, may not be as beneficial. Conversely, waiting too long to introduce a playpen may also limit its effectiveness. As babies become more mobile and curious, they may require more supervision and may not be content to stay in one place for long periods.
When your baby learns to climb out or push the pen over (often around 2.5 to 3 years old, or when they reach 35 inches in height), it is time to move to a more open, but fully child-safe, home.
Can a Baby Sleep in a Playpen Every Night?
The short answer is: It is not a good idea to use a standard playpen for sleeping every night. The key is to know the difference between a โPlaypenโ (just for play and short naps) and a โPlay Yardโ or โPortable Cribโ (a travel bed). Many modern items are multi-use “play yards” that meet safe sleep rules (like a firm bottom and air-flow sides).
If the item is clearly marked as a โportable cribโ that meets safety standards, and the mattress is thin and firm, then it can be used for safe sleep, including at night. But a normal playpen often does not have a hard mattress. Its main use is for safe play, and it should not be used as a place for nighttime sleep.
It is recommended not to let your child sleep in a playpen at night. Instead, provide a safe and comfortable sleeping environment in a baby bed or bassinet that meets safety standards and supports healthy sleep habits.
Factors to Consider When Choosing a Baby Playpen

Safety Features: Sturdy construction, non-toxic materials, secure locking mechanisms, and mesh panels that provide good airflow and visibility.
Size and Configuration: For families with limited space or those who travel frequently, a compact, lightweight model may be ideal. Conversely, larger playpens can offer more space for play and may include additional features such as integrated toys or activity centers. Some playpens are adjustable or modular, allowing you to customize the size and shape to fit your space.
Ease of Cleaning: Opt for baby fences with removable, machine-washable fabric or easy-to-clean surfaces for quick and hassle-free cleaning.
Stability: Check the stability of the playpen, ensuring it has sturdy legs and a stable base to prevent tipping or wobbling, especially if your baby is active and may try to climb or pull on the sides.

How to Stop Baby Playpen from Moving?
As your baby gets stronger, they will soon find it fun to push the playpen around. This can harm your floor. More importantly, it can make the pen shaky or even tip over. Therefore, the following measures can be taken to prevent:
Use Anti-Slip Pads: Place pads made of rubber or silicone under the playpen’s four corners. These pads create enough grip to hold slick surfaces well.
Add Weight to the Bottom: Put a strong, washable rug or mat inside the pen. This helps spread the weight evenly on the bottom. It also lowers how much the pen can shake.
Anchor to the Wall: If the playpen has anchor points or loops for securing it to the wall, use safety straps or anchors to attach it firmly to the wall.
Place Against a Wall: Position the playpen against a wall or sturdy furniture to provide additional support and stability. This helps prevent the playpen from shifting or moving when your baby moves around inside.
How to Clean Baby Playpen?
A playpen is where your baby plays, snacks, and drools. Because of this, cleaning it often is very important. You can break down good cleaning into two parts: daily care and deep cleaning.
For daily care, just use a wet cloth and mild, non-toxic soap, and water. Wipe down the pen’s sides and top rails. Always wipe it clean with plain water to make sure no soap is left behind.
Deep cleaning takes more time, and we suggest doing it once a month. First, take off any fabric parts that can be removed, like pads or liners. Wash them in a machine as the maker suggests. For the mesh and plastic frame, you can use a small amount of white vinegar mixed with water (1 part vinegar to 4 parts water). This will clean germs and remove smells. This mix is safe and natural.
When you are done cleaning, always let the playpen air-dry fully to stop mold or bad smells from starting, especially in all the tight spots.
Tips for Using Baby Playpens Effectively
Regularly Rotate Toys: Keep your baby engaged by rotating the toys and activities available in the playpen. Include toys with different textures, colors, and sounds to stimulate their senses and encourage exploration.
Create a Comfortable Environment: Use a soft mat or padding on the floor to provide a cushioned surface for your baby to sit and play on.
Establish a Routine: Incorporate playpen time into your baby’s daily routine to help them become familiar with the space and develop a sense of routine and structure. it’s essential to balance playpen time with other activities and interactions throughout the day. Limit playpen sessions to short periods to prevent your baby from becoming overly reliant on it for entertainment.
Promote Independence: Encourage your baby to explore and play independently within the playpen. This helps foster their sense of independence and self-confidence as they learn to entertain themselves.
FAQ
Q: How do I set up a baby playpen?
A: Setting up a baby playpen typically involves unfolding the frame, securing any locking mechanisms, and adding any desired accessories or toys. Follow the baby furniture manufacturer’s instructions carefully to ensure proper assembly and safety.
Q: How Long Can a Baby Stay in a Playpen?
A: The duration a baby can stay in a playpen varies depending on their age, mobility, and level of contentment. It’s important to monitor the baby for signs of restlessness or discomfort and to balance playpen time with other activities and interactions.
Q: How can I prevent my child from climbing out of the playpen?
A: To prevent your child from climbing out of the playpen, choose a playpen with high sides or mesh panels that are difficult to climb, remove any objects or toys that could be used for climbing, and supervise your child closely while they are in the playpen.
Q: Can Playpens Be Used Outdoors?
A: Many playpens are designed for both indoor and outdoor use, featuring durable materials and UV protection. However, ensure the playpen is placed on a stable surface and in a shaded area to protect the baby from direct sunlight and heat.
Q: Are there any alternatives to baby playpens?
A: Yes, alternatives to baby playpens include using baby gates to create a safe play area in a room, using a large blanket or mat on the floor for supervised play, or baby-wearing to keep your child close while you move around the house.
